Joint Ventures

Joint ventures can be a powerful mechanism for businesses to pursue growth, enter new markets, and leverage synergies. Our joint venture services assist clients in assessing the feasibility, structuring, and negotiation of joint ventures. We help clients identify potential partners, evaluate strategic fit, develop business models, and establish governance frameworks. Our team brings a deep understanding of joint venture dynamics and provides expert guidance to ensure successful collaborations.
